Apple Pay Now Integrated with PlayStation 5

Sony has officially introduced Apple Pay as the latest payment method on the PlayStation 5 (PS5). This innovation allows users to purchase games and digital content more quickly and conveniently directly from the console, simply by scanning a QR code with their iPhone.

Fast and Secure Payment Method

Thanks to Apple Pay’s tokenization system, every transaction is secure as no real card numbers are shared with third parties, including Sony. Users only need to scan a QR code displayed on their PS5 screen, then complete the checkout process via their iPhone. Apple Card holders also receive an automatic 2% cashback on purchases.

Limited Availability and Access

Unfortunately, the feature is currently available only in selected regions such as the United States. Users in Asia and Europe must wait for further announcements from Sony regarding broader availability. PS4 users have not yet received this feature, although Sony is reportedly considering future updates.

Critical Netizen Questions and Sony’s Response

Many netizens have raised concerns over the absence of Google Pay, potential over-reliance on Apple, and the risk of user data sharing. However, Sony has clarified that Apple Pay is merely an additional option—not a replacement for existing methods like PayPal or debit/credit cards. There are no added fees, and all transactions are subject to strict privacy policies from both companies.
